History of Ahmedabad, Gujarat

Contents

1 copy of Muntakhab-i aḥvāl-i zayn al-bilād Aḥmad'ābād

Brief history of Ahmedabad in Gujarat (India) from the period preceding the Muslim sultanates to that of Raghunath Rao's rule, possibly compiled by the scribe

Scribe: Mānik Lāʿl ibn Tarang Laʿl of the qawm Bhram Khatrī, resident of Ahmedabad, completed [for Kinoch Forbes] at the haveli of Munshi Bhola Nath son of Sara Bhay

Dated: 11 Shaʿbān 1265/3 July 1849

Language(s): Persian
